Google Drive Projects with Workspace Intelligence has several hidden features that make it more powerful than a basic file organizer, giving you smarter ways to manage active work across your team. One underused capability is the ability to ask Gemini questions across all files inside a Project at once—rather than opening each document individually, you can query your entire Project context in Workspace for synthesized answers drawn from your Docs, Sheets, Slides, and uploads in one response. For teams managing complex deliverables like product launches, client accounts, or research initiatives, this Workspace Intelligence saves significant time when you need to find a specific decision, data point, or reference buried across multiple documents. Another hidden strength of Google Drive Projects is how it surfaces Workspace Intelligence signals that standard folder views don't expose, including recent activity, suggested collaborators, and contextual file recommendations based on what you're working on. When you're onboarding someone new to a project or preparing for a client review, Projects can show relevant files you might have overlooked rather than requiring you to remember every document you saved weeks earlier. This is particularly useful for ongoing workstreams where file accumulation makes manual navigation slow, such as sales cycles, editorial calendars, legal matters, or cross-functional product teams where contributors are adding files across different time zones. Google Drive Projects also connects naturally with Gemini Notebooks, which means the sources and context you build in a Project can feed directly into a Notebook for deeper AI-assisted analysis, output generation, and knowledge synthesis without recreating your file set from scratch. For Workspace users who already rely on Drive for collaboration, this integration closes the gap between passive file storage and active, AI-powered project management.
